
A Daily Morning Practise For Calm & Positivity
A daily morning practise combining gratitude, meditation and positive affirmations to start your day from a space of calm and positivity. A practise to help you shift into a positive focus and mindset. Try this meditation everyday for at least 3 weeks and see if you notice a difference in your mood and outlook. What happens in the first 30 minutes of your day has a profound impact on the rest of the day.
Taking time to get into the right mindset and nourishing yourself mentally has a positive effect over the rest of your day and how you deal with challenges that arise,
The way you interact with others,
The choices and decisions you make and how you feel physically,
Mentally,
Emotionally and spiritually.
Having a daily practice that you can use in the first 30 minutes of your day will set up your day in the right way and will have a positive impact on your life,
Your happiness and your wellbeing.
So before we start I'd just like you to take a moment to look around the room you are in and count the number of things that you can see that are black.
If there's nothing black then perhaps choose a different colour and just count how many of those things you can see.
Got that number?
Now close your eyes and give me the exact number of things in your room that are of blue.
And if you use blue the first time you can choose another colour.
Now if you've done this correctly you will not be able to give me a number of blue items because unless you have memorised your room you can't see them.
In the same way we can choose to focus on negativity or positivity.
If you spend your day thinking everything is against me then all you will see are the things,
Circumstances and situations that you feel are against you.
Like the focus on the black items.
And you will close your eyes to all the positive things,
All the blue coloured items that are around you.
However if you can catch yourself saying I'm having a bad day or everything's against me and you can change that to what a beautiful day or what a great day or wow positive things are happening for me today then that is what you will see,
That is what you will focus on and you will draw more of that into your awareness.
We can really encourage a good mindset and start the day from a space of calm and positivity by practising gratitude which has been proven to alter brain chemistry in just 26 seconds.
Meditation which connects us to the space of calm and peace which we then can take into our day and positive affirmations which are a powerful tool in changing the negative beliefs and negative thought patterns we have.
Mahatma Gandhi is quoted to have said,
Your beliefs become your thoughts,
Your thoughts become your words,
Your words become your actions,
Your actions become your habits,
Your habits become your values and your values become your destiny.
This can help to realign our beliefs and thoughts to have a positive impact on our lives which then ripples out to positively impact those around us.
So I encourage you to try this meditation every morning for at least 3 weeks,
That's 21 days and see if you notice a difference in your mood and your outlook.
